CVE-2017-7651 describes a denial-of-service vulnerability in Eclipse Mosquitto version 1.4.14, affecting various Debian-based distributions. An unauthenticated attacker can crash the Mosquitto server by initiating numerous connections with large payloads, leading to memory exhaustion. This high-severity vulnerability (CVSS 7.5) requires no authentication and has a low attack complexity, allowing for a complete denial of service. Despite its potential impact, there is no evidence of active exploitation, public exploit code, or significant community discussion surrounding this CVE.
